The Eastblok label already surprised us on previous occasions, but their latest production is really a curiosity. 'Polska Rootz' brings together a number of groups from the Polish underground circuit and serves up an eclectic musical mix of folk, electro and reggae. Reggae fans will certainly recognize some names: 'Pierso Godzina/Don't Betray My Love' is a collaboration between Polish folk band Trebunie Tutki and Twinkle Brothers and 'Vavamuffin' by Sekta was remixed by Zion Train's Neil Perch.
